Are You Replacing Good Balls Far Too Early?

You can save a little on the quote and still lose badly on the program. The ugliest waste in range-ball buying is not broken inventory. It is visually failed inventory.

A ball does not need to crack to become a procurement failure. If it still flies but already looks dull, yellowed, or budget-grade on the tee, your club starts paying replacement cost for cosmetic drift rather than true physical wear-out.

sorted range golf balls in factory bins for quality control and wholesale supply

This is where low-cost buying turns into false economy. One end-of-life curve is structural: cracking, severe scuffing, or real performance decline. The other is visual: yellow cast, uneven gloss, patchy finish, or a tray that suddenly looks below club standard. Premium facilities often retire balls on the second curve long before the first curve arrives. That means the replacement budget is being driven by appearance failure rather than by the ball’s actual playable life.

For procurement managers, this is the most frustrating type of waste because it looks irrational from every angle except member perception. The core may still be sound. The cover may still be intact. The ball may still perform acceptably for range use. Yet the inventory becomes commercially unusable because the club can no longer put it in front of members without downgrading the experience. Cheap coating decisions do not just lower quality. They can shorten the usable life of perfectly serviceable inventory.

That is why sample-to-shipment appearance discipline matters so much. Request the retained master sample, the first-article approval record, and the batch-level WI/YI/ΔE format used to release production. Bright sample, but no batch WI/YI/ΔE record, is a classic warning sign because it leaves your receiving team with no objective bridge between what was approved and what actually lands. If the supplier cannot show how appearance is controlled lot by lot, your team is still exposed to surprise scrap.

A clean receiving rule makes this enforceable. One useful clause is: “Receiving acceptance will be based on the agreed visual and instrument appearance window versus the approved master, including WI/YI/ΔE record format, daylight inspection condition, and rejection handling for visibly yellowed lots.” That sentence turns a vague complaint into a controlled buy spec.

The stronger procurement decision is not the ball that looks cheapest on a spreadsheet. It is the ball your club can keep on the tee longer without having to apologize for how it looks.

Why Do Some White Range Balls Yellow So Fast?

Two white balls can leave the factory looking almost identical. The difference often appears later, under sun, handling, gloss loss, and repeated exposure where weak finish systems begin to show.

The real buying question is not whether a ball starts white. It is whether the finish was engineered to stay presentation-ready longer under repeated UV exposure, daily handling, and the cosmetic stress that premium range programs put on outdoor inventory.

white and yellowed golf balls in quality control comparison for OEM manufacturing

The short buyer version is this: some low-cost coating systems rely on chemistries with weaker UV color stability, so they can look acceptably bright at the start and still shift yellow earlier under outdoor exposure. That is a safer way to frame the risk than pretending one cheap formula always fails the same way. What matters to your team is not naming a single villain chemistry. It is recognizing that not every white finish is designed for the same level of UV-exposed club use.

A supplier-grade premium route should be positioned as a UV-stability-first finish strategy rather than a generic white finish. That normally means a more stable clear-coat route, a balanced UV-stabilizer package, and controlled brightness optimization rather than a simplistic “whiter is better” formula story. Serious anti-yellowing work is about keeping the finish visually stable for longer, not just creating a bright day-one sample.

This is also where materials language has to stay disciplined. “More brightener” is not a professional buying answer. Brightness-enhancing additives can be useful, but they need to sit inside a balanced stabilizer approach rather than being treated as a magic fix. A smart supplier should be able to explain the finish route in buyer language: what the coating is trying to protect, what kind of comparative exposure logic supports the positioning, and what records the procurement team can actually file.

Application quality matters just as much as chemistry. A ball can leave the line white and still age badly if layer thickness drifts, surface prep is inconsistent, or the finish wears unevenly and loses gloss in patches. Ask how thickness is controlled, how comparative wear is screened, and whether release checkpoints include finish appearance rather than only weight and compression. For a premium club program, a coating story is not enough. You need a finish-control system.

What Should a UV Test Report Actually Prove?

Suppliers love big test-hour numbers because they sound scientific. Your team should care less about the number itself and more about whether the comparison logic is clear enough to defend internally.

A usable UV report does not just say “500 hours passed.” It shows what was tested, under what disclosed conditions, against what control, at which checkpoints, and how the appearance changed in terms your team can compare against production release.

golf balls on UV weathering test board for quality control and OEM manufacturing

As of early 2026, the buying problem remained the same: suppliers could still hide weak evidence behind impressive hour counts. A weathering claim becomes useful only when the exposure conditions are disclosed. That is why a serious comparison should show the chamber method, exposure setup, checkpoint photos, control logic, and the appearance outputs used to judge change. Without that structure, a “500-hour test” is just a dramatic sentence.

For premium club use, the goal is not to convert chamber hours into outdoor months. The goal is to compare finish routes under the same stress and see which one keeps a cleaner, more stable appearance. That is where WI, YI, and ΔE become useful. They connect what the eye sees to what the release file records. A proper comparison pack should show 0h, 250h, and 500h checkpoints under disclosed conditions, not one flattering end-state image with no story behind it.

To make the file truly useful for internal review, ask for more than the UV snapshots. Besides the disclosed QUV or ASTM G154 conditions and comparison photos, the file can also include the coating-thickness record and a comparative abrasion screen for the clear-coat system. That gives your team a more complete picture of whether the finish is only color-stable in the chamber or also robust enough to stay presentation-ready in use.

The best reports also connect the lab comparison to production control. If the supplier cannot explain how the approved sample, the production lot, and the release checkpoint talk to each other, the UV report is floating by itself. A “stays white” claim with no disclosed exposure conditions should be treated as a filter, not as a buying reason.

If you want to screen suppliers quickly, put this directly into the RFQ: “Please provide your disclosed QUV/ASTM G154 test conditions, 0h/250h/500h comparison evidence, batch-level WI/YI/ΔE QC format, and the production-lot linkage used to keep sample appearance consistent with shipment.”

Will Your Logo and Delivery Stay Presentation-Ready?

A premium-looking finish can still lose the argument after printing, packing, transit, or receiving. Appearance control is not finished when the ball leaves the coating line.

A premium-looking sample is not enough if the custom mark fades early or the shipment lands visually tired. Your club standard has to survive printing, packaging, transit heat, storage light, and the receiving routine on your side.

custom branded golf balls with sample boxes for logo review and OEM approval

Logo durability is often treated like decoration when it should be treated like brand protection. Members do not separate the printed mark from the rest of the ball. If the logo blurs, fades, or sits under a finish that yellows around it, the whole tray looks cheaper. Ask how the print is protected, whether the clear coat is helping or merely sitting nearby, and what comparison method is used to judge mark retention under outdoor handling. Logo durability promise with no UV-ink or packout proof is another buying trap.

The shipment itself can also undo a good sample. Heat, light, and weak outer protection can leave landed inventory looking older than it should. That is why packout standards matter for premium club orders. Ask for the outer-pack protection logic, how the balls are shielded during transit and storage, and what arrival-side inspection method the supplier recommends. If you are using a door-to-door model, that should reduce logistics friction, not reduce receiving discipline.

This is also where written operating maturity matters. A reliable supplier does not just send cartons and reply with general reassurance when something drifts. It should be able to lock the written spec early, keep the retained master consistent, document packout and print settings, and define what happens if a landed lot misses the agreed appearance window. For repeat orders, the written spec, retained master, and corrective-action path should remain identical across replenishment cycles.

FAQ

How many side-by-side samples should you compare before a bulk order?

Do not approve from one pretty sample alone. Compare at least one control and one candidate under the same light, then keep an approved master so every future receiving check has something real to judge against.

One sample can tell you whether a ball looks promising. It cannot tell you whether the look is stable enough for a premium range program. Compare a control and a candidate under the same daylight condition, then keep one retained master in the buying file. Ask whether production lots are released against that standard or merely against a broad phrase such as premium white.

What should a whiteness QC sheet include?

A useful sheet helps your team compare batches, not just admire a lab number. It should link appearance results to lot traceability, instrument condition, operator trace, and a clear release or hold decision.

For club buying, the point of a whiteness sheet is operational control. It should show the lot reference, inspection date, the WI/YI/ΔE format used versus the approved master, the instrument note or viewing condition, who ran the check, and whether the lot was released or held. If the record cannot help receiving staff decide whether landed inventory matches the approved sample, it is not doing its job.

Can you trust a “500-hour QUV” claim without the cycle details?

No. Hour count without disclosed conditions is weak evidence, because your team still cannot tell what stress was applied, what control was used, or how appearance was measured at each checkpoint.

A test-hour number sounds technical, but it only becomes useful when the comparison is fully described. Ask for the chamber method, the exposure conditions, the control ball, the checkpoint logic, and the photo sequence rather than one final image. Then ask how those lab results connect to batch release. If the supplier cannot explain that bridge, the report is floating by itself.

What receiving checks catch visual damage before balls hit the range?

Use a simple arrival routine under consistent light: open cartons, compare the landed lot with the retained master, spot-check logo clarity, and record any yellow shift before internal release.

You do not need a giant laboratory to prevent a visibly tired rollout. You need discipline. Open the cartons under a consistent daylight-equivalent condition, compare spot-checked balls to the approved retained sample, watch for yellow cast, gloss drift, or print weakness, and document any obvious exception before the lot reaches operations. Then send that exception back to the supplier with the lot reference attached.
